When a structure or part thereof is found by
the Code Official to be unsafe, or when a structure or part thereof
is found unfit for human occupancy or use or is found unlawful, it
shall be condemned pursuant to the provisions of this code and shall
be placarded and vacated. It shall not be reoccupied without the approval
of the Code Official. Unsafe equipment shall be placarded and placed
out of service.
A. An unsafe structure is one in which all or part thereof
is found to be dangerous to life, health, property or the safety of
the public or its occupants because it is so damaged, decayed, dilapidated,
structurally unsafe or of such faulty construction or unstable foundation
that it is likely to partially or completely collapse.
B. A structure is unfit for human occupancy or use whenever
the Code Official finds that it is unsafe, unlawful or, because of
the degree in which it lacks maintenance or is in disrepair, is unsanitary,
contains filth and contamination or lacks ventilation or heating facilities
or other essential equipment required by this code, or because its
location constitutes a hazard to its occupants or to the public.
C. An unlawful structure is one found erected, altered
or occupied contrary to law.
If the structure or part thereof is vacant and
unfit for human habitation, occupancy or use and is not in danger
of structural collapse, the Code Official may post a placard of condemnation
on the premises and may order the structure closed up so it will not
be an attractive nuisance. Upon failure to the owner to board up all
openings to the premises within 30 days, the Code Official shall cause
it to be boarded up through any available public agency or by contract
or arrangement by private persons, and the cost thereof shall be charged
against the real estate upon which the structure is located and shall
be a lien upon such real estate.
After the condemnation notice required under
the provisions of this code has resulted in an order by virtue of
failure to comply within the time given, the Code Official shall post
on the premises or structure or parts thereof or on defective equipment
a placard bearing the words "Condemned as unfit for human occupancy
or use" and a statement of the penalties provided for any occupancy
or use or for removing the placard. Any person who shall occupy a
placarded premises or structure or part thereof or shall use placarded
equipment and any owner or any person responsible for the premises
who shall let anyone occupy a placarded premises shall be liable for
the penalties provided by this code. The Code Official shall remove
the condemnation placard whenever the defect or defects upon which
the condemnation and placarding action were based have been eliminated.
Any person who defaces or removes a condemnation placard without the
approval of the Code Official shall be subject to the penalties provided
by this code.
